Thermal Imaging Camera For Critical Equipment Monitoring
Fixed-mounted thermal imaging cameras like the FLIR A310 can be installed almost anywhere to monitor your critical equipment and other valuable assets. It will safeguard your plant and measure temperature differences to assess the criticality of a given situation. This allows you to see problems before they become costly failures, preventing downtime and enhancing worker safety.

System Overview | FLIR A310 |
Spotmeter | 10 |
Area | 10 boxes with max./min./average/position |
Isotherm | 1 with above/below/interval |
Measurement option | Measurement Mask Filter Schedule response: File sending (ftp), email (SMTP) |
Difference temperature | Delta temperature between measurement functions or reference temperature |
Reference temperature | Manually set or captured from any measurement function |
Atmospheric transmission correction | Automatic, based on inputs for distance, atmospheric temperature and relative humidity |
Optics transmission correction | Automatic, based on signals from internal sensors |
Emissivity correction | Variable from 0.01 to 1.0 |
Reflected apparent temperature correction |
Automatic, based on input of reflected temperature |
External optics/windows correction | Automatic, based on input of optics/window transmission and temperature |
Measurement corrections | Global and individual object parameters |
Field of view (FOV) / Minimum focus distance |
25° × 18.8° / 0.4 m (1.31 ft.) |
Lens identification | Automatic |
Thermal sensitivity/NETD | < 0.05°C at +30°C (86°F) (86°F) / 50 mK |
Focus | Automatic or manual (built in motor) |
F-number | 1.3 |
Image frequency | 30 Hz |
Zoom | 1–8× continuous, digital, interpolating zooming on images |
